Denver-Based Tech Company, Aureus Tech Systems, Modernizes the Legal Space With e-Discovery Solution, Anvesa


DENVER, August 21, 2019 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- Aureus Tech Systems' subsidiary company, Common Source, LLC., focused on e-Discovery for litigation, launches a new and improved version of their flagship e-Discovery product, Anvesa.

Aureus realized that e-Discovery platforms for plaintiff attorneys were few and far between so, Anvesa, powered by Microsoft Azure, was built from the ground up. Anvesa gives plaintiff attorneys an integrated experience for early case assessment, an efficient search and review function, and document production from one single platform. The solution eliminates the arduous task of jumping to and from separate, fragmented systems, reducing challenges around competency, cooperation, search terms, lack of tools, and unnecessary costs that litigation teams often face. Additionally, Anvesa provides plaintiff attorneys with a way to find "holes" while reviewing opposing counsels' productions during the early case assessment, which is critical in this phase.

Anvesa is built on the premise of microservices using Azure. This "building block" approach allows for agility in development, enabling quicker releases to clients and faster evolution within an ever-changing business environment. Traditional applications built around monolithic frameworks can be difficult and time-consuming to fix, but Anvesa is able to precisely scale up or down, allowing for deployment flexibility, making fixes fast and easy.

Additionally, Anvesa's use of Azure Cognitive Services and Azure Machine Learning breaks down complex information into digestible key insights, offering users the ability to search and compile documents and find patterns with superior speed and ease.

With many other e-Discovery platforms, there is a chasm between product development and customer service. Customers can't go to service providers and advise them on product changes since service providers have little influence on the software vendor's product roadmap. Because Aureus is both a solutions and product provider, there is a direct feedback loop to product engineering. Therefore, customers have the ability to influence the product roadmap as well as receive necessary training and support.
